I have just started getting into Google Chromecast and have, sadly, discovered that many of my video files won’t cast with sound. I’ve since learned it’s because Chromecast does not support AC3 or DTS audio.

So I need an app that can re-encode audio WITHOUT re-encoding video as well, since the video plays fine in Chromecast, just without sound.

I don’t have access to a windows machine right now, so I need an app that I can run on my android tablet.

Is there an app that can do this? Free or paid, doesn’t matter.
